imtoken官网版app下载:深入解析 imToken 封装,原理、应用与未来展望

作者:imtoken钱包下载 2026-04-15 浏览:394
导读: 本文聚焦imToken官网版app下载,深入解析imToken封装相关内容,详细阐述其原理,剖析其在加密货币管理等方面的应用情况,imToken作为热门的数字钱包应用,在用户存储、交易加密资产等过程中发挥着重要作用,通过对其封装的研究,能更好地理解其运行机制和优势,还对imToken的未来进行展望,...
本文聚焦imToken官网版app下载,深入解析imToken封装相关内容,详细阐述其原理,剖析其在加密货币管理等方面的应用情况,imToken作为热门的数字钱包应用,在用户存储、交易加密资产等过程中发挥着重要作用,通过对其封装的研究,能更好地理解其运行机制和优势,还对imToken的未来进行展望,探讨其在不断发展的加密货币市场中可能面临的机遇与挑战,为相关从业者和用户提供有价值的参考。

在当今这个区块链技术如日中天、飞速发展的时代,数字资产的管理与交易已然成为了人们关注的焦点,数字资产市场的蓬勃兴起,让其管理和交易变得愈发重要,imToken 作为一款在数字钱包领域声名远扬的应用,宛如一颗璀璨的明星,为广大用户提供了便捷且安全的数字资产存储与交易服务,而 imToken 封装,更是在 imToken 这一坚实基础上衍生出的一种先进技术手段,它宛如一把神奇的钥匙,对于提升数字钱包的功能、增强安全性以及优化用户体验都有着举足轻重的意义,本文将全方位、深入地探讨 imToken 封装的相关内容,涵盖其原理、丰富的应用场景以及充满无限可能的未来发展趋势。

imToken 概述

(一)imToken 的定义与特点

imToken 是一款专为移动端打造的轻钱包 App,宛如一个功能强大的数字宝库,它支持多种主流数字货币,像比特币(BTC)、以太坊(ETH)等都能在其中安全存放,它具备以下显著特点:

  1. 安全可靠:如同一位忠诚的卫士,imToken 采用了多重加密技术,全力保障用户的私钥安全,私钥就像是打开数字资产大门的钥匙,是用户访问和管理数字资产的关键所在,imToken 通过本地加密存储、密码保护等多种方式,精心守护私钥,确保其不被泄露,让用户的数字资产稳如泰山。
  2. 操作便捷:其用户界面设计简洁直观,仿佛是为每一位用户量身定制的操作指南,无论是初涉数字资产领域的新手,还是经验丰富的投资者,都能轻松上手,如同行云流水般进行数字资产的存储、转账等操作,毫无压力。
  3. 功能丰富:imToken 不仅仅是一个普通的钱包,它更像是一个数字生态系统,除了具备基本的钱包功能外,它还支持去中心化应用(DApp)的访问,用户可以在钱包内直接使用各种 DApp,参与 DeFi(去中心化金融)等热门活动,开启数字资产的多元应用之旅。

(二)imToken 在数字资产领域的地位

imToken 在数字资产领域占据着至关重要的地位,它就像是数字资产世界中的一座灯塔,成为了众多用户管理数字资产的首选钱包之一,随着区块链技术的广泛普及和数字资产市场的持续发展,imToken 的用户数量如同雨后春笋般不断增加,其影响力也在不断扩大,它不仅为用户提供了安全、便捷的数字资产管理服务,还如同催化剂一般,推动了区块链技术的广泛应用和蓬勃发展。

imToken 封装的原理

(一)封装的概念

封装,就像是给软件系统穿上了一层保护衣,它是指将软件系统中的某些部分进行打包和隐藏,只对外提供特定的接口,这样做的好处是可以大大提高软件的安全性、可维护性和可扩展性,在 imToken 封装中,就是把 imToken 的某些功能或模块进行精心封装,以满足不同用户或开发者多样化的需求。

(二)imToken 封装的技术实现

  1. 代码层面的封装
    • 开发者如同技艺精湛的工匠,将 imToken 的核心功能代码进行封装,形成独立的模块,将数字资产的转账功能封装成一个函数,其他程序就可以像调用魔法咒语一样,通过调用这个函数来实现转账操作,这样一来,不仅提高了代码的复用性,还能减少重复开发,节省大量的时间和精力。
    • 在封装过程中,开发者需要像对待珍贵艺术品一样对代码进行优化和加密,确保代码的安全性,要严格遵循一定的编程规范,让代码具有良好的可读性和可维护性,方便后续的开发和升级。
  2. 接口封装
    • imToken 就像是一个开放的宝藏库,为开发者提供了一系列的 API(应用程序编程接口),开发者可以通过这些 API 轻松地调用 imToken 的功能,例如获取用户的数字资产余额、发起转账等操作。
    • 接口封装的好处显而易见,它就像是一座桥梁,让开发者可以更方便地将 imToken 的功能集成到自己的应用中,而无需深入了解 imToken 的内部实现细节,接口的设计要严格遵循一定的标准,确保不同开发者之间的兼容性,让数字资产的交互更加顺畅。

(三)封装对 imToken 安全性的影响

  1. 增强安全性
    • 封装就像是给敏感信息和核心功能加上了一把坚固的锁,将它们隐藏起来,大大减少了被攻击的风险,私钥的存储和管理是数字钱包安全的核心关键,通过封装可以将私钥的操作封装在一个安全的模块中,避免私钥直接暴露在外部环境中,如同将珍贵的宝物藏在安全的密室里。
    • 封装还具备强大的加密功能,在数据传输和存储过程中,对数据进行加密处理,确保数据的安全性,在进行数字资产转账时,对转账信息进行加密,就像给信息穿上了一层隐形的保护衣,防止信息被窃取和篡改。
  2. 潜在的安全风险 封装过程并非十全十美,如果存在漏洞,就可能会导致安全问题,接口的设计不合理,就可能会被攻击者利用来获取用户的敏感信息,在进行 imToken 封装时,需要进行严格的安全测试,就像对一座建筑进行全面的质量检测一样,确保封装的安全性。

imToken 封装的应用场景

(一)企业级应用

  1. 金融机构 金融机构可以充分利用 imToken 封装来开发自己的数字资产钱包应用,通过封装 imToken 的功能,金融机构就像拥有了一个强大的魔法工具,可以快速推出符合自身需求的钱包产品,为客户提供数字资产存储和交易服务,银行可以开发一款基于 imToken 封装的数字钱包,为客户提供比特币、以太坊等数字资产的托管和交易服务,这样一来,不仅可以满足客户对数字资产投资的需求,还能为银行拓展业务领域,开辟新的盈利渠道。
  2. 科技企业 科技企业也可以将 imToken 封装集成到自己的应用中,为用户提供数字资产相关的功能,一家互联网公司可以在自己的社交应用中集成 imToken 封装,让用户可以在社交平台上轻松进行数字资产的转账和交易,这样不仅可以增加应用的功能和用户粘性,还能为数字资产的推广和应用提供更广阔的平台,让数字资产走进更多人的生活。

(二)个人开发者应用

  1. DApp 开发 个人开发者可以利用 imToken 封装来开发去中心化应用(DApp),通过封装 imToken 的功能,开发者就像拥有了一把神奇的钥匙,可以更方便地实现 DApp 与数字钱包的交互,让用户可以在 DApp 中直接进行数字资产的操作,开发者可以开发一款基于以太坊的 DApp,用户可以在该 DApp 中进行代币的购买、销售和交易,通过 imToken 封装,用户可以直接使用自己的 imToken 钱包进行操作,大大提高了用户体验,让数字资产的交易变得更加便捷。
  2. 定制化钱包开发 个人开发者还可以根据自己的需求,利用 imToken 封装开发定制化的数字钱包,开发者可以开发一款专注于某一种数字资产的钱包,或者开发一款具有特殊功能的钱包,这样可以满足不同用户的个性化需求,同时也为开发者提供了更多的创新空间,让数字钱包的世界更加丰富多彩。

imToken 封装面临的挑战与解决方案

(一)技术挑战

  1. 兼容性问题 不同版本的 imToken 和不同的操作系统就像是不同的语言,可能会导致兼容性问题,某些功能在某个版本的 imToken 上可以正常使用,但在另一个版本上可能会出现问题,为了解决这个问题,开发者需要进行充分的测试,就像对不同的乐器进行调试一样,确保封装的功能在不同版本的 imToken 和不同的操作系统上都能正常运行,要及时关注 imToken 的更新动态,对封装代码进行相应的调整,让数字资产的操作始终保持顺畅。
  2. 性能优化 封装可能会像给系统增加了一些负担,增加系统的开销,影响性能,在进行数字资产转账时,封装的代码可能会导致转账速度变慢,为了解决这个问题,开发者需要对封装代码进行优化,采用高效的算法和数据结构,就像给汽车换上更强劲的发动机一样,减少系统的开销,还可以通过分布式计算等技术来提高系统的性能,让数字资产的交易更加高效。

(二)安全挑战

  1. 私钥管理 私钥是数字资产安全的核心,就像守护宝藏的密码一样重要,封装过程中需要确保私钥的安全,如果私钥泄露,用户的数字资产将面临巨大的风险,为了保障私钥的安全,需要采用多重加密技术对私钥进行存储和管理,同时设置严格的访问权限,还可以使用硬件钱包来存储私钥,就像将珍贵的宝物放在坚固的保险箱里,提高私钥的安全性。
  2. 网络安全 封装后的应用就像是一座暴露在网络世界中的城堡,可能会面临网络攻击,如 DDoS 攻击、黑客攻击等,为了保护这座城堡的安全,需要加强网络安全防护,采用防火墙、入侵检测等技术来保护系统的安全,要及时更新系统的安全补丁,就像给城堡加固城墙一样,防止漏洞被利用,确保数字资产的安全。

imToken 封装的未来发展趋势

(一)与区块链技术的深度融合

随着区块链技术的不断发展,imToken 封装将与区块链技术进行更深度的融合,就像两颗相互吸引的星球,它们将紧密结合在一起,利用区块链的智能合约技术,实现数字资产的自动化管理和交易,通过封装智能合约的功能,用户可以更方便地进行数字资产的托管、投资等操作,让数字资产的管理更加智能化、自动化。

(二)跨链封装的发展

不同的区块链之间就像一道道无形的屏障,存在着隔离,数字资产的跨链交易存在一定的困难,而 imToken 封装可能会成为打破这些屏障的利器,支持跨链功能,实现不同区块链之间数字资产的自由转移,通过封装跨链协议和技术,用户可以在不同的区块链之间进行数字资产的交易和管理,让数字资产在不同的区块链世界中自由流通。

(三)与物联网的结合

随着物联网技术的蓬勃发展,物联网设备将产生大量的数据和价值,imToken 封装可以与物联网技术相结合,就像为物联网设备插上了数字资产的翅膀,实现物联网设备之间的数字资产交易和管理,智能家电可以通过 imToken 封装实现与用户数字钱包的连接,用户可以通过数字资产支付家电的使用费用,让数字资产的应用场景更加广泛。

imToken 封装是一项具有重要意义的技术,它为数字资产的管理和交易提供了更多的可能性,通过封装,imToken 的功能可以更好地满足不同用户和开发者的需求,同时也提高了数字钱包的安全性和可扩展性,虽然 imToken 封装面临着一些挑战,但随着技术的不断发展和完善,这些挑战将逐渐得到解决,imToken 封装将与区块链技术、物联网等领域进行更深度的融合,为数字资产的发展和应用带来新的机遇,我们满怀期待,相信 imToken 封装在未来能够发挥更大的作用,推动数字资产市场的繁荣发展。

文章围绕 imToken 封装展开,从 imToken 概述、封装原理、应用场景、面临的挑战以及未来发展趋势等方面进行了详细的阐述,希望能为你对 imToken 封装的理解提供有益的帮助。

token 封装到请求头”,通常在前后端交互中,为了进行身份验证等操作,会将 token 封装到 HTTP 请求头中,以下是一个简单的 JavaScript 示例代码,展示如何将 token 封装到请求头里:

// 假设已经获取到了 token
const token = "your_token_here";
// 创建一个 HTTP 请求
const request = new XMLHttpRequest();
request.open('GET', 'your_api_url', true);
// 设置请求头,将 token 封装进去
request.setRequestHeader('Authorization', `Bearer ${token}`);
// 发送请求
request.send();

在上述代码中,我们通过 setRequestHeader 方法将 token 封装到了 Authorization 请求头中,使用 Bearer 方案,后端可以通过解析这个请求头来验证用户身份,在实际开发中,根据不同的后端框架和需求,可能会有不同的封装方式和请求头字段。

转载请注明出处:imtoken钱包下载,如有疑问,请联系()。
本文地址:https://www.kmcrj.com/vvuj/5956.html